    Kia Motors recalls 37,358 minivans

    Detroit News staff, wire and Bloomberg News reports

    WASHINGTON -- Kia Motors America, Inc., is recalling more than 37,000 minivans because of potential damage to a rear wheel bearing that could cause a crash, the company said Wednesday. Kia said a defect might exist on 37,358 Kia Sedona minivans from the 2003-2005 model years equipped with alloy wheels. Company engineers found that moisture can accumulate around the small steel cap that seals the rear hub and bearing assembly on alloy wheels, leading to damage to the wheel bearing. The company said the damage can occur without warning and cause a crash. The company is unaware of any accidents caused by the defect.

    diesoline, yup, for diesel engines, only the opacimeter column has values, the gas analyzer column are all zero. For gas, its the other way around naman. Yung values nakalagay sa certificate mo, kulang. For your reference, the complete data for the opacimeter readings are:

    < dec 31, 2002 nat-2.5, turbo-3.5 1000M elevation 4.5
    >=jan 1, 2003 nat 1.2, tur 2.2, 1000M elevation 3.2

    Dates are based on registration date. So any cars registered before dec31 2002, uses the 1st row figures. All cars registered 2003 and onwards, uses the 2nd row figures.
